3D Printing in Dental Surgery



To improve the field of dental surgery, you can explore the subtopic of 3D printing in dental surgery. This innovative innovation has the potential to revolutionize the way oral specialists run and treat patients. Below are four vital ways in which 3D printing is shaping the field:

- ** Customized Surgical Guides **: 3D printing enables the creation of extremely exact and patient-specific surgical guides, enhancing the precision and performance of treatments.

- ** Implant Prosthetics **: With 3D printing, dental specialists can produce personalized implant prosthetics that perfectly fit an individual's distinct anatomy, causing far better results and individual satisfaction.

- ** Bone Grafting **: 3D printing enables the production of patient-specific bone grafts, minimizing the demand for typical grafting techniques and improving recovery and healing time.

- ** Education and Training **: 3D printing can be utilized to create practical medical models for academic purposes, permitting dental cosmetic surgeons to practice complex procedures before executing them on individuals.

With its potential to improve precision, customization, and training, 3D printing is an exciting advancement in the field of dental surgery.
